An opportunity to view Faces of the Somme Exhibition through the eyes of the soldiers of the Royal Warwickshire Regiment.

The first day of the Battle of the Somme had the greatest loss of life in British Army history - out of nearly 60,000 casualties, a third were fatalities.

As we mark the 110th anniversary of this offensive, this is an opportunity for visitors to explore the different perspectives of those who experienced the carnage first-hand, from regular soldiers to officers, from those who survived to those who were amongst the tragic loss of life in the bloodiest battle of the Great War.

Linked to this exhibition, there are family activities and opportunities to dress up in the uniform and kit of a soldier of the Somme.
